Two new treatment options offer fresh hope for skin cancer patients

Published
There are promising developments in the fight against melanoma with two new treatment options offering fresh hope for patients. Overnight, new trial results presented in the U.S. show the potential of a new cancer vaccine to deliver a nearly 50% reduction in the rate of recurrence or death over three years. In trials, the vaccine was used in combination with an immunotherapy drug in patients previously diagnosed with melanoma. Meanwhile, separate research, involving Australian scientists, has made a breakthrough - finding a powerful combination of immunotherapy drugs, given before cancer removal, can also drastically improve survival rates.
